当前位置: 代码迷 >> J2EE >> 启动 mysql 服务异常,很奇怪的有关问题
  详细解决方案

启动 mysql 服务异常,很奇怪的有关问题

热度:670   发布时间:2016-04-17 23:53:06.0
启动 mysql 服务错误,很奇怪的问题
新手啊,刚下的最新版的mysql,一切都配置好了,然后启动命令用
net start mysql提示服务无法启动,错误1067,进程意外禁止,但是
如果输入命令,start mysql就能启动了,为什么啊?好奇怪啊,
启动结果如下图所示

------解决方案--------------------
首先找到这个文件: 默认安装路径

C:/Program Files/MySQL/MySQL Server 5.1/my.ini

 

打开此文件找到:default-storage-engine=INNODB   大概在84行。

 

将default-storage-engine的值改为:MYISAM,这个时候,MYSQL服务可以启动。

 

 

但是还有问题:因为以前你创建的那些数据库还是存在的(如果没有删除),

 

默认路径:

C:/Documents and Settings/All Users/Application Data/MySQL/MySQL Server 5.1/data

 

这时可能会出来这种问题:

 

   第一次设置的efault-storage-engine与第二次设置的值不一样,可能会导致 

1:发现无法选择添加事务支持数据引擎InnoDB

2:可能会说不支持InnoDB等

 

解决方法:

 删除:ib_logfile0

          ib_logfile1

          ibdata1

重启服务,再次生成就OK了
  相关解决方案